Effect of ploidy on the mortality of Crassostrea gigas spat caused by OsHV-1 in France using unselected and selected OsHV-1 resistant oysters ArchiMer
Degremont, Lionel; Ledu, Christophe; Maurouard, Elise; Nourry, Max; Benabdelmouna, Abdellah.
The effect of ploidy on the mortality of Crassostrea gigas spat caused by the ostreid herpesvirus (OsHV-1) genotype μVar was investigated at five sites along the Atlantic coast in France in 2011. Sibling diploids and triploids were produced using either unselected or selected OsHV-1-resistant oysters. No significant interactions were found between the factors of environment, genotype and ploidy at the endpoint dates. The mean mortality rates at the sites were 62 and 59% for diploids and triploids, respectively, and the two rates were not significantly different. The mean mortality rates were 33 and 32% for sibling diploids and triploids, respectively, when OsHV-1-resistant parents were used, and 91 and 85%, respectively, when unselected parents were used....

Is horizontal transmission of the Ostreid herpesvirus OsHV-1 in Crassostrea gigas affected by unselected or selected survival status in adults to juveniles? ArchiMer
Degremont, Lionel; Guyader, Tanguy; Tourbiez, Delphine; Pepin, Jean-francois.
Massive mortality outbreaks, mostly affecting spat Crassostrea gigas, have been reported in France since 2008. Disease investigations revealed that most of the mortality events are related to the detection of the Ostreid herpesvirus 1 (OsHV-1 μVar). Meanwhile, selection to improve the survival in juvenile C. gigas has been successfully implemented in this context and selected oysters were found disease-resistant to OsHV-1 infection. This paper reports the first investigation of the horizontal transmission of the disease throughout cohabitation trials within batch and between batches using unselected and selected oysters for their higher survival. Mortality associated with OsHV-1 in spat Crassostrea gigas: role of wild-caught spat in the horizontal transmission of the disease ArchiMer
Degremont, Lionel; Benabdelmouna, Abdellah.
The French oyster production of Crassostrea gigas is based on two sources of spat: wild-caught (WC) and hatchery-produced (HP). Massive mortality related to the ostreid herpesvirus type 1 (OsHV-1) has affected both sources in France since 2008. We investigated the mortality in juvenile C. gigas due to the horizontal transmission of OsHV-1 within (separated condition) and between (mixed condition) the two spat sources in three environments from April to June 2010. In the separated condition, no mortality was observed in the HP batches, while the WC batches experienced moderate to high mortality (40–80 %).
